'We're investigating overbilling, kickbacks,' FBI office says.
Four employees have been placed on paid administrative leave, pending the outcome of the criminal investigation.
"We're investigating overbilling, kickbacks, and bribe payments made to employees of the Bossier Parish school system in return for air conditioning work to be funneled to one company," said Steve Hall, a senior agent with the FBI's Shreveport office. "The investigation is progressing rapidly."
Air Repair, a Bossier City-based business, was contracted by the school district to install air conditioning units in various schools. Bossier Schools Superintendent Ken Kruithof said the school district is no longer doing business with the defunct company.
